WebTerms in this set (10) RIGHT-SIDED HEART FAILURE. may be caused by LEFT VENTRICULAR heart failure, RIGHT MYOCARDIAL INFARCTION (MI), or PULMONARY HTN. In this type of HF, the RIGHT VENTRICLE CANNOT EMPTY completely. WebFeb 20, 2024 · BNP evaluates fluid load status and possible congestive heart failure. CT scan of the chest will look for anatomical abnormalities. An echocardiogram is used to evaluate left ventricular ejection fraction, right ventricular function, pulmonary artery pressure, valvular function, pericardial effusion, and any hypokinetic area.
